Abstract
We reformulate some of Moeglin's results on the correspondence for the dual pairs (Sp(2n,R), O(p,q)) with p and q even, and fill in the cases where p and q are both odd. We arrive at a complete and detailed description, in terms of Langlands parameters, of the dual pair correspondence for the cases p+q=2n and p+q=2n+2. In addition, we point out and suggest a way to correct an error in Moeglin's paper.
